Zuckerberg Faces Shareholders at Contentious Facebook Meeting

May 31, 2018, 9:00 PM UTC

It was not a normal Facebook Inc. shareholder meeting.

On Thursday in Menlo Park, California, one investor compared the social network’s poor stewardship of user data to a human rights violation. Another warned that scandal is not good for Facebook’s bottom line. And one advised Chief Executive Officer Mark Zuckerberg to emulate George Washington, not Vladimir Putin, and avoid turning Facebook into a “corporate dictatorship.”
